Movielogr

movie poster

Rating: 8 stars

Tags

NWI Japan teenagers violence island

Seen 1 time

Seen on: 07/06/2012 (rewatch)

Related Events

View on: IMDb | TMDb

Battle Royale (2000)

Directed by Kinji Fukasaku

Action | Science Fiction | Thriller

Most recently watched by sensoria, sleestakk, sleestakk

Overview

In the future, the Japanese government captures a class of ninth-grade students and forces them to kill each other under the revolutionary “Battle Royale” act.

Rated NR | Length 122 minutes

Actors

Chiaki Kuriyama | Takeshi Kitano | Tatsuya Fujiwara | Aki Maeda | Taro Yamamoto | Kou Shibasaki | Anna Nagata | Masanobu Ando | Yūko Miyamura | Satomi Hanamura | Takayo Mimura | Sousuke Takaoka | Takashi Tsukamoto | Mikiya Sanada | Kanako Fukaura | Yuuki Masuda | Yukihiro Kotani | Eri Ishikawa | Sayaka Kamiya | Aki Inoue | Yutaka Shimada | Ren Matsuzawa | Hirohito Honda | Kazutoshi Yokoyama | Minami | Ryouji Sugimoto | Yasuomi Sano | Shin Kusaka | Ai Iwamura | Shiro Go | Shigeki Hirokawa | Asami Kanai | Mai Sekiguchi | Tsuyako Kinoshita | Satomi Ishii | Sayaka Ikeda | Tomomi Shimaki | Tamaki Mihara | Yukari Kanasawa | Misao Kato | Hitomi Hyuga | Haruka Nomiyama | Takako Baba | Shigehiro Yamaguchi | Yousuke Shibata | Michi Yamamura | Takeyuki Hirai | Tomu Asakawa | Yûya Nakahara | Takashi Komori | Ryôta Nakamura | Akihiro Ugajin | Yôichi Murakami | Tsuguharu Niizaki | Jun'ichi Nashiki | Hiroshi Kitagawa | Hideaki Kawashima | Umiji Tasaki | Hidetsugu Okumura | Daisuke Yazawa | Nobuki Baba | Naoki Iwasawa | Kôji Tokuhisa | Kazuhiro Yokokura | Shigeki Homma | Kazuo Araki | Gôshi Matsuhara | Akira Yoshizawa | Kenzo Shirahama | Kanji Okumura | Shôji Takano | Hajime Yoneda | Hideaki Kojima | Gou Ryugawa | Ken Nakaide | Gouki Nishimura | Osamu Ohnishi | Satoshi Yokomichi | Junichi Naitou | Mitsuaki Tachikawa | Takashi Taniguchi | Ryou Nitta | Ai Maeda

Viewing Notes

I hadn’t watched this in quite a while and I’m happy to say it still holds up pretty well, though the violence seems almost quaint in comparison to a number of movies I’ve seen since this was released.

The premise also remains as silly as it ever was. The plot is, for the most part, just an excuse to get down and dirty with ‘shocking’ (for its time) teen-on-teen violence, which is an extension of the typical angst and sociological difficulties normal teenagers face on a daily basis. In this case, instead of not being invited to the cool kids party, you’re hunted down and killed with a machete. Or in this case, you show up with a gun at the cool kids party and wreak havoc.

I streamed this off Netflix Instant Watch in HD and the quality was pretty damn good. Part of my Battle Royale Double Feature Friday.

Comments

No comments yet. Log in and be the first!

  BENCHMARKS  
Loading Time: Base Classes  0.0016
Controller Execution Time ( Members / Movie Detail )  0.1764
Total Execution Time  0.1780
  GET DATA  
No GET data exists
  MEMORY USAGE  
545,704 bytes
  POST DATA  
No POST data exists
  URI STRING  
members/sensoria/movie_detail/8526
  CLASS/METHOD  
members/movie_detail
  DATABASE:  movielogr_dev (Members:$db)   QUERIES: 17 (0.1584 seconds)  (Hide)
0.0003  
SELECT 1
FROM `ml_sessions`
WHERE `id` = '6ba3d704d5db15cf0525c7a3124a85da25c0f806'
AND `ip_address` = '216.73.216.6' ?>
0.1518  
SELECT GET_LOCK('5a48eae28d99dbbadaaf4334531ff95a', 300) AS ci_session_lock ?>
0.0004  
SELECT `data`
FROM `ml_sessions`
WHERE `id` = '6ba3d704d5db15cf0525c7a3124a85da25c0f806'
AND `ip_address` = '216.73.216.6' ?>
0.0004  
SELECT `username`, `user_id`
FROM `ml_users`
WHERE `username` = 'sensoria'
 LIMIT 1 ?>
0.0003  
SELECT `MV`.`title_id`, `MT`.`tmdb_id`
FROM `ml_movie_titles` `MT`
LEFT JOIN `ml_movies` `MV` ON `MV`.`title_id` = `MT`.`title_id`
WHERE `MV`.`movie_id` = 8526
AND `MV`.`user_id` = 1
 LIMIT 1 ?>
0.0004  
SELECT `star_rating`
FROM `ml_users`
WHERE `ml_users`.`user_id` = 1
 LIMIT 1 ?>
0.0003  
SET SESSION group_concat_max_len = 12288 ?>
0.0026  
SELECT `MV`.`title_id`, `MV`.`movie_id`, COUNT(DISTINCT MV.title_id) AS mv_count, `title`, `prefix`, `year`, `imdb_link`, `MT`.`imdb_id`, `MT`.`tmdb_id`, `overview`, `certification`, `runtime`, `genre_id_01`, `genre_id_02`, `genre_id_03`, MAX(MP.filename) AS filename, `G1`.`genre_name` AS `genre_name_01`, `G2`.`genre_name` AS `genre_name_02`, `G3`.`genre_name` AS `genre_name_03`, `date_viewed`, `notes`, `MV`.`format_id`, `FMT`.`format_name`, `MV`.`source_id`, `SRC`.`source_name`, `MV`.`device_id`, `DVC`.`device_name`, `MV`.`rating_id`, `STR`.`star_rating`, `rewatch`, GROUP_CONCAT(DISTINCT(DR.director_name) ORDER BY DR.tmdb_director_id ASC SEPARATOR "|") AS directors, GROUP_CONCAT(DISTINCT(DR.tmdb_director_id) ORDER BY DR.tmdb_director_id ASC SEPARATOR "|") AS director_ids, GROUP_CONCAT(DISTINCT(ACT.actor_name) ORDER BY ACT.tmdb_actor_id ASC SEPARATOR "|") AS actors, GROUP_CONCAT(DISTINCT(ACT.tmdb_actor_id) ORDER BY ACT.tmdb_actor_id ASC SEPARATOR "|") AS actor_ids
FROM `ml_movie_titles` `MT`
LEFT JOIN `ml_movies` `MV` ON `MV`.`title_id` = `MT`.`title_id`
LEFT JOIN `ml_movie_posters` `MP` ON `MV`.`title_id` = `MP`.`title_id`
LEFT JOIN `ml_lookup_genres` `G1` ON `MV`.`genre_id_01` = `G1`.`genre_id`
LEFT JOIN `ml_lookup_genres` `G2` ON `MV`.`genre_id_02` = `G2`.`genre_id`
LEFT JOIN `ml_lookup_genres` `G3` ON `MV`.`genre_id_03` = `G3`.`genre_id`
LEFT JOIN `ml_lookup_formats` `FMT` ON `MV`.`format_id` = `FMT`.`format_id`
LEFT JOIN `ml_lookup_sources` `SRC` ON `MV`.`source_id` = `SRC`.`source_id`
LEFT JOIN `ml_lookup_devices` `DVC` ON `MV`.`device_id` = `DVC`.`device_id`
LEFT JOIN `ml_movie_ratings_ten_star` `STR` ON `MV`.`rating_id` = `STR`.`rating_id`
LEFT JOIN `ml_junction_movies_directors` `JMD` ON `MT`.`title_id` = `JMD`.`title_id`
LEFT JOIN `ml_directors_new` `DR` ON `JMD`.`tmdb_director_id` = `DR`.`tmdb_director_id`
LEFT JOIN `ml_junction_movies_actors` `JMA` ON `MT`.`title_id` = `JMA`.`title_id`
LEFT JOIN `ml_actors_new` `ACT` ON `JMA`.`tmdb_actor_id` = `ACT`.`tmdb_actor_id`
WHERE `MV`.`movie_id` = 8526
AND `MV`.`user_id` = 1
ORDER BY `date_viewed` DESC ?>
0.0002  
SET SESSION group_concat_max_len = 1024 ?>
0.0003  
SELECT `event_title`, `JME`.`event_id`
FROM `ml_junction_movies_events` `JME`
LEFT JOIN `ml_movie_events` `EV` ON `JME`.`event_id` = `EV`.`event_id`
WHERE `JME`.`movie_id` = 8526 ?>
0.0003  
SELECT `tag`, `JMT`.`tag_id`
FROM `ml_junction_movies_tags` `JMT`
LEFT JOIN `ml_tags` `MT` ON `JMT`.`tag_id` = `MT`.`tag_id`
WHERE `JMT`.`movie_id` = 8526 ?>
0.0002  
SELECT `star_rating`
FROM `ml_users`
WHERE `ml_users`.`user_id` = 1
 LIMIT 1 ?>
0.0002  
SELECT `rating_id`
FROM `ml_movies` `MV`
WHERE `MV`.`user_id` = 1
AND `MV`.`movie_id` = 8526
 LIMIT 1 ?>
0.0002  
SELECT `star_rating`
FROM `ml_movie_ratings_ten_star` `MR`
WHERE `MR`.`rating_id` = '18'
 LIMIT 1 ?>
0.0003  
SELECT `MV2`.`date_viewed`, `MV2`.`movie_id`
FROM `ml_movies` `MV`
LEFT JOIN `ml_movies` `MV2` ON `MV`.`title_id` = `MV2`.`title_id` AND `MV`.`user_id` = `MV2`.`user_id`
WHERE `MV`.`user_id` = 1
AND `MV`.`movie_id` = 8526
GROUP BY `MV2`.`movie_id`
ORDER BY `MV2`.`date_viewed` DESC ?>
0.0002  
SELECT `comment_id`, `comment`, `commenter_id`, `timestamp`, `username`, `email_address`
FROM `ml_comments` `MC`
JOIN `ml_users` `MU` ON `MU`.`user_id` = `MC`.`commenter_id`
WHERE `movie_id` = 8526 ?>
0.0002  
SELECT `username`, `date_viewed`, `MV`.`movie_id`
FROM `ml_users` `MU`
JOIN `ml_movies` `MV` ON `MV`.`user_id` = `MU`.`user_id`
JOIN `ml_movie_titles` `MT` ON `MT`.`title_id` = `MV`.`title_id`
WHERE `MT`.`title_id` = 5026
ORDER BY `date_viewed` DESC
 LIMIT 10 ?>
  HTTP HEADERS  (Show)
  SESSION DATA  (Show)
  CONFIG VARIABLES  (Show)